WebMay 13, 2024 · After Montag shot Beatty with his flamethrower, he hobbles through the city until he falls face first on the ground. While lying on the ground, he realizes that “Beatty wanted to die.” (Bradbury 116) Montag believes Captain Beatty wanted to die because he just stood there and dared Montag to shoot him. WebApr 12, 2024 · He loves what he destroys. Beatty loves books and the wisdom they give yet has been conditioned to destroy them. He is tearing himself apart. Beatty is a very sad man underneath all that aggression. He was baiting Montag because he really had enough. Log in with Facebook

WebCaptain Beatty could have seen Montag destroy the books and couldn’t bear the pain any longer, so he wanted to be put out of his misery. Another reason why Beatty wanted to die was that he realized he despised the fast-paced futuristic society in which he lived. What is the best place for Montag to pursue Beatty?
